Output 14758ed5909872b1d663dab67c5a63bf9bbbc0d208ecc44bca22b286e56dad74:1

value
503036449
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c83e82e6ea95a0787c2c38abc0dfda93d4661339 OP_EQUALVERIFY OP_CHECKSIG
address
1KFo2jLEE5p8d6Tg7PmjyCQRDUJ9DWeWLn
transaction
14758ed5909872b1d663dab67c5a63bf9bbbc0d208ecc44bca22b286e56dad74
spent
true